Platform engineers debugging dropped traffic in Kubernetes clusters need kube-iptables-tailer because it surfaces iptables denials that your CNI and observability stack deliberately hide. The tool catches the networking friction that costs you hours in incident response, and it asks for nothing in return; 550 GitHub stars confirms adoption in production clusters where this signal gap matters. Skip this if your team runs service mesh with full request-level logging or if you're still on non-iptables network policies, since the value collapses when you already have that visibility layer.
